The Schneider Electric 140CPU65150 is a 150 MHz CPU module for the Modicon Quantum Automation Platform — a workhorse of process control in oil & gas, power generation, water treatment, and heavy manufacturing. As Schneider Electric advances its EcoStruxure migration roadmap, genuine Quantum-series CPU stock is contracting. | Part Number | 140CPU65150 |
| Brand | Schneider Electric (Modicon) |
| Series | Quantum Automation Platform – Unity |
| Category | PLC Processor / CPU Module |
| Processor Speed | 150 MHz |
| Memory | 7 MB RAM (application) / 8 MB Flash |
| Communication Ports | Modbus Plus, Ethernet TCP/IP (Modbus), USB |
| Programming Software | Unity Pro (IEC 61131-3 compliant) |
| Operating Temperature | 0°C to 60°C |
| Country of Origin | France |
| Product Status | Mature / End-of-Active-Production — Verified spare stock available |
